Window Replacement
Windows are crucial for comfort in the home as well as energy efficiency and security. They also keep your home cool, especially in the summer. If your windows are damaged or are difficult to open and close It's time to call for window replacement services. A window replacement service will replace your windows with energy-efficient, modern units. They can also install vents to ensure continuous ventilation.
A window installation company can help you choose between a pocket or full frame installation. Full-frame installations involve replacing the entire window, including the frame, trim and sill. They are typically required when you want a different style or the existing window is in a state of significant rot. Pocket installations are a straightforward and cost-effective method of replacing a window. The company you choose should be capable of describing the pros and cons of each type of installation to assist you in making the right decision for your needs.
Most window manufacturers offer a range of options for new windows, including double and triple pane units with energy efficient technology. Insulated glass and window film stop air leaks and transfer of energy, which means you will have a more comfortable living space and your heating and cooling system will not have to perform as hard.

Hydrophobic Coating
Hydrophobic coatings are a surface treatment that blocks water from a substrate, thus cutting down on maintenance costs. It also helps prevent corrosion, etching and stains. It can be applied to many different surfaces, including glass. It is used in many industries that include aerospace, automotive and construction. In addition to repelling water, a hydrophobic coating increases visibility and safety.
Hydrophobic coatings can be applied on glass surfaces to create an automatic cleaning effect. It also helps protect against scratches during cleaning procedures. This is especially important for aircraft windows. A scratched glass can cause a loss of visibility and hinder the pilot’s vision.
The coating has a lower surface tension, which reduces the amount of force required to apply it to a surface. It is able to be applied to nearly any surface including glass and other transparent materials. The coating can either be sprayed or applied with brushes and rollers. In any case, it is important to use a quality product that is safe for the substrate.
The surface of a hydrophobic coating usually smooth, but the coating can be modified to provide more or less roughness. The roughness determines how much the coating repels water. Coatings that have contact angles of 150 degrees or more are deemed to be super-hydrophobic.
Hydrophobic coatings can be utilized to protect a range of surfaces such as glass, metal textiles, electronics, and even textiles devices. They are able to resist harsh chemicals and high temperatures. They also have anti-graffiti and anti-fingerprint properties. These properties make them ideal for a variety of applications that include protecting interiors and exteriors of vehicles, building façades, and aircraft surfaces.

Glass Tints
A window tint is a tinted glass color that alters the amount of solar energy that can pass through. It also provides privacy to a room or block out unwanted views. There are a variety of window tints, and each one has distinct effects on the appearance and performance of the glass. Window tint is usually composed of polyester, and can be treated in a variety of ways. There are tints that are frosted to provide privacy and thicker and stronger to protect against break-ins. There are even options that are designed to cut down on glare from TVs and computer screens.
It is important to remember that the darker the tint, the less clear of the view. This is why it is important to select the tint that is similar in shade to the frame of the window. You should also choose the right tint that matches the decor and style of your home. This can make a huge impact on the look of the room.
You can also apply window tints to guard furniture from sun damage. Sun bleaching is a process of furniture that is upholstered losing its color when exposed to direct sunlight. Tinted windows reflect and absorb the majority of the harmful rays to protect furniture and keep it looking new.
In addition to being aesthetically pleasing, window tints can also save on utility bills. It is important to note that tinted windows do not eliminate glare on computer and television screens. If you're considering having your windows tinted it is recommended to do so in conjunction with a double or triple-pane insulated window unit because this will give you the most effective results.
It is important to keep in mind that tinted windows can void your window warranty. This means that the manufacturer of your window refurbishment cannot cover any problems like seal failures or degradation.
